Is the word organizar the same in Brazilian and European Portuguese?

Yes

The word "organizar" is identical in meaning, spelling, and grammatical conjugation in both Brazilian and Continental Portuguese. The only difference is in pronunciation.

In Brazilian Portuguese, the pronunciation tends to be more "open," with more distinct, melodic vowels and a rhythm that is more syllable-timed. The "r" at the end of the word can vary significantly depending on the region (for example, an aspirated "r" in Rio de Janeiro or a retroflex "r" in the interior). In Continental Portuguese, the pronunciation is more "closed" and "stress-timed," meaning vowels are often reduced or swallowed, making the speech sound more consonant-heavy.

Brazilian Portuguese Examples

  1. Eu preciso organizar meu quarto. (I need to organize my room.)
  2. Vamos organizar uma festa de aniversário. (Let's organize a birthday party.)
  3. Ela está organizando os arquivos no computador. (She is organizing the files on the computer.)
  4. Você pode organizar os documentos para mim? (Can you organize the documents for me?)
  5. Precisamos organizar nossa viagem de férias. (We need to organize our vacation trip.)

Continental Portuguese Examples

  1. Eu preciso de arrumar o meu quarto. (I need to tidy my room.)
  2. Vamos organizar uma festa de aniversário. (Let's organize a birthday party.)
  3. Ela está a organizar os ficheiros no computador. (She is organizing the files on the computer.)
  4. Podes organizar os documentos para mim? (Can you organize the documents for me?)
  5. Precisamos de organizar a nossa viagem de férias. (We need to organize our vacation trip.)
